What Is a Digital Footprint?
A digital footprint is everything you leave behind online, like social media activity including profiles, posts, photos, or messages and replies, blogs, web searches, browsing history, .

How Do You Leave a Digital Footprint?
You leave a digital footprint when you use the internet, post pictures, write messages, or watch videos.
Activities That Create Footprints
Writing messages, liking posts, sharing photos, and searching online all add to your digital footprint.

Positive Implications
Helps create a positive image of you for others to see, including employers.
Widens your social profile by promoting you.
Shows other people your skills and learn about you in a good way.

Negative Implications
Reduces your privacy
Reduces information security
Can impact on your personal safety by over sharing personal information
Negative online activities and social media profiles can be seen by a wide audience, including employers
